How much do remote electrical engineering j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ote electrical engineering in Prosper, TX is $101,736.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$76,000.00 and $120,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ote electrical engineer?

A remote electrical engineer is a professional who designs, develops, tests, and supervises the manufacturing of electrical equipment and systems while working from a location outside a traditional office or on-site setting. Using digital tools and communication platforms, they collaborate with teams, manage projects, and perform technical tasks from home or other remote locations. This role is ideal for those who have strong technical skills, are self-motivated, and can work independently while ensuring that all engineering standards and deadlines are met.

How do remote electrical engineers typically collaborate with on-site teams to ensure successful project delivery?

Remote electrical engineers often use collaboration tools like video conferencing, cloud-based design platforms, and project management software to stay connected with on-site teams. They participate in regular virtual meetings to discuss project updates, resolve technical challenges, and coordinate design changes. Clear communication and detailed documentation are essential to bridging the physical distance, ensuring that all stakeholders are aligned on project requirements and timelines. Successfully working remotely in this role requires proactive engagement and strong organizational skills to manage tasks effectively across locations.

What is the difference between Remote Electrical Engineering vs Remote Electronics Engineering?

AspectRemote Electrical EngineeringRemote Electronics Engineering
Required CredentialsBachelor's or higher in Electrical Engineering, PE license often preferredBachelor's or higher in Electronics Engineering or related field
Work EnvironmentDesigning electrical systems, power distribution, circuit analysisDesigning electronic circuits, embedded systems, PCB layout
Employer & Industry UsageUtilities, manufacturing, aerospace, automotiveConsumer electronics, telecommunications, embedded device companies
Common Search & ComparisonRemote Electrical EngineeringRemote Electronics Engineering

Remote Electrical Engineering focuses on power systems, electrical infrastructure, and large-scale electrical design, while Remote Electronics Engineering emphasizes circuit design, embedded systems, and electronic device development.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ds but differ in industry applications and technical focus.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ote electrical eng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Electrical Engineer, you need a solid background in electrical engineering principles, problem-solving abilities, and a relevant degree such as a BS or MS in Electrical Engineering. Proficiency with CAD software, circuit simulation tools, and familiarity with industry standards and certifications like PE (Professional Engineer) are typically required. Strong communication, self-motivation, and time management skills help remote engineers collaborate effectively and manage projects independently. These skills ensure accurate project execution, effective teamwork across locations, and the ability to deliver reliable engineering solutions remotely.

Job Description
AECOM has a position available for a Substation Engineer with a specialization in physical substation design. The focus of your experience must be in the power delivery industry and be associated with electrical engineering with respect to the design of utility scale substation design.
  • Performs specific and limited portions of a broader assignment of an experienced engineer
  • Gathers and correlates basic engineering data using established and well-defined procedures.
  • Works on detailed or routine engineering assignments involving calculations and relatively simple tests.
  • Proposes approach to solve new problems encountered.
  • Identifies discrepancies in results.
  • Performs work in accordance with agreed upon budget and schedule with moderate supervision.

Qualifications
Minimum Requirements:
  • Bachelor's degree in electrical engineering and 2 years of relevant experience or demonstrated equivalency of experience and/or education.
  • Experience with high voltage substation design.
  • EIT Certification.
  • Proficient in use of AutoCAD and/or Bentley Microstation.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Professional engineering license or ability to obtain one within 2 years of hire.
  • Knowledge of construction practices and constructability
  • Experience with proposal writing and project estimating.
  • Working knowledge of scheduling and project controls processes.
  • Good knowledge of the industry and technology trends specific to substations.
  • Familiar with applicable codes and standards (IEEE, ANSI, NESC, NEC).
  • Working knowledge of MS Office (Word, Excel, etc.) a must.
  • Attention to detail and check the quality of own and others' work
  • Ability to use sound engineering judgment.
  • Ability to manage time and workload effectively, which includes planning, organizing, and prioritizing with attention to details.
